Alex Anzalone Sidelined by Hamstring as Contract Talks Stall

Having sat out of practice with a hamstring issue, he has voiced disappointment at the Lions’ delay in extending his contract.

  • He has told team officials he wants to retire as a Lion and called the ongoing contract stalemate “weird.”
  • Some observers have speculated that his hamstring injury could serve as leverage in negotiations, though neither side has confirmed that.
  • Anzalone led all NFL linebackers in man-coverage snaps last season and earned a 73.7 coverage grade from Pro Football Focus.
  • Detroit’s front office must balance re-signing a four-time team captain against preserving cap space for extensions of young stars like Aidan Hutchinson.
